Is 7627903 a prime number?
It is possible to find out using mathematical methods whether a given integer is a prime number or not.
No, 7 627 903 is not a prime number.
For example, 7 627 903 can be divided by 139: 7 627 903 / 139 = 54 877.
For 7 627 903 to be a prime number, it would have been required that 7 627 903 has only two divisors, i.e., itself and 1.
